/**
 * Types an object-merging operation's result.
 */
export type MergeResult<T extends Record<string, any>, NewT> = (Omit<T, keyof NewT> & {
    [K in keyof NewT]-?: K extends keyof T ?
    (
        T[K] extends Record<string, any> ?
        (NewT[K] extends Record<string, any> ? MergeResult<T[K], NewT[K]> : never) :
        (NewT[K] extends Record<string, any> ? never : T[K] | NewT[K])
    ) : NewT[K]
}) extends infer R ? { [K in keyof R]: R[K] } : never;

/**
 * Types individual dictionary values and inflates them.
 */
export type InflateKey<TKey extends string, TValue extends ConfigurationValue, TSep extends string, TPrefix extends string = ""> = TKey extends `${TPrefix}${infer FullKey}` ?
    FullKey extends `${infer Key}${TSep}${infer Rest}` ?
    {
        [K in Key]: InflateKey<Rest, TValue, TSep>
    } :
    {
        [K in FullKey]: TValue;
    } : never;

/**
 * Inflates entire dictionaries into their corresponding final objects.
 */
export type InflateDictionary<TDic extends Record<string, ConfigurationValue>, TSep extends string, TPrefix extends string = ""> = {
    [K in keyof TDic]: (x: InflateKey<K & string, TDic[K], TSep, TPrefix>) => void
} extends Record<keyof TDic, (x: infer I) => void> ? I : never;

/**
 * Defines the capabilities required from configuration builders.
 */
export interface IBuilder<T extends Record<string, any> = {}> {
    /**
     * Adds the provided data source to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the 
     * configuration object.
     * @param dataSource The data source to include.
     */
    add<NewT extends Record<string, any>>(dataSource: IDataSource<NewT>):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, NewT>>;
    /**
     * Adds the specified object to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the configuration 
     * object.
     * @param obj Data object to include as part of the final configuration data, or a function that returns said 
     * object.
     */
    addObject<NewT extends Record<string, any>>(obj: NewT | (() => Promise<NewT>)):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, NewT>>;
    /**
     * Adds the specified dictionary to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the configuration 
     * object.
     * @param dictionary Dictionary object to include (after processing) as part of the final configuration data, 
     * or a function that returns said object.
     * @param hierarchySeparator Optional hierarchy separator.  If none is specified, a colon (:) is assumed.
     * @param prefix Optional prefix.  Only properties that start with the specified prefix are included, and the 
     * prefix is always removed after the dictionary is processed.  If no prefix is provided, then all dictionary 
     * entries will contribute to the configuration data.
     */
    addDictionary<TDic extends Record<string, ConfigurationValue>, TSep extends string = ':'>(dictionary: TDic | (() => Promise<TDic>), hierarchySeparator?: TSep, prefix?: string):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, InflateDictionary<TDic, TSep>>>;
    /**
     * Adds the specified dictionary to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the configuration 
     * object.
     * @param dictionary Dictionary object to include (after processing) as part of the final configuration data, 
     * or a function that returns said object.
     * @param hierarchySeparator Optional hierarchy separator.  If none is specified, a colon (:) is assumed.
     * @param predicate Optional predicate function that is called for every property in the dictionary.  Only when 
     * the return value of the predicate is true the property is included in configuration.
     */
    addDictionary<TDic extends Record<string, ConfigurationValue>, TSep extends string = ':'>(dictionary: TDic | (() => Promise<TDic>), hierarchySeparator?: TSep, predicate?: Predicate<string>):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, InflateDictionary<TDic, TSep>>>;
    /**
     * Adds the qualifying environment variables to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the 
     * configuration object.
     * @param env Environment object containing the environment variables to include in the configuration, or a 
     * function that returns said object.
     * @param prefix Optional prefix.  Only properties that start with the specified prefix are included, and the 
     * prefix is always removed after processing.  To avoid exposing non-application data as configuration, a prefix 
     * is always used.  If none is specified, the default prefix is OPT_.
     */
    addEnvironment<TDic extends Record<string, ConfigurationValue>, TPrefix extends string = 'OPT_'>(env: TDic | (() => Promise<TDic>), prefix?: TPrefix):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, InflateDictionary<TDic, '__', TPrefix>>>;
    /**
     * Adds a fetch operation to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the configuration object.
     * @param url URL to fetch.
     * @param required Optional Boolean value indicating if the fetch must produce an object.
     * @param init Optional fetch init data.  Refer to the fecth() documentation for information.
     * @param processFn Optional processing function that must return the configuration data as an object.
     */
    addFetched<NewT extends Record<string, any>>(url: URL | (() => Promise<URL>), required?: boolean, init?: RequestInit, processFn?: ProcessFetchResponse<NewT>):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, NewT>>;
    /**
     * Adds a fetch operation to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the configuration 
     * object.
     * @param request Request object to use when fetching.  Refer to the fetch() documentation for information.
     * @param required Optional Boolean value indicating if the fetch must produce an object.
     * @param init Optional fetch init data.  Refer to the fecth() documentation for information.
     * @param processFn Optional processing function that must return the configuration data as an object.
     */
    addFetched<NewT extends Record<string, any>>(request: RequestInfo | (() => Promise<RequestInfo>), required?: boolean, init?: RequestInit, processFn?: ProcessFetchResponse<NewT>):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, NewT>>;
    /**
     * Adds the specified JSON string to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the 
     * configuration object.
     * @param json The JSON string to parse into a JavaScript object, or a function that returns said string.
     * @param jsonParser Optional JSON parser.  If not specified, the built-in JSON object will be used.
     * @param reviver Optional reviver function.  For more information see the JSON.parse() documentation.
     */
    addJson<NewT extends Record<string, any>>(json: string | (() => Promise<string>), jsonParser?: IJsonParser<NewT>, reviver?: (this: any, key: string, value: any) => any):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, NewT>>;
    /**
     * Adds a single value to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the configuration object.
     * @param path Key comprised of names that determine the hierarchy of the value.
     * @param value Value of the property.
     * @param hierarchySeparator Optional hierarchy separator.  If not specified, colon (:) is assumed.
     */
    addSingleValue<TKey extends string, TValue extends ConfigurationValue, TSep extends string = ':'>(path: TKey, value?: TValue, hierarchySeparator?: TSep):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, InflateKey<TKey, TValue, TSep>>>;
    /**
     * Adds a single value to the collection of data sources that will be used to build the configuration object.
     * @param dataFn Function that returns the [key, value] tuple that needs to be added.
     * @param hierarchySeparator Optional hierarchy separator.  If not specified, colon (:) is assumed.
     */
    addSingleValue<TKey extends string, TValue extends ConfigurationValue, TSep extends string = ':'>(dataFn: () => Promise<readonly [TKey, TValue]>, hierarchySeparator?: TSep): IBuilder<MergeResult<T, InflateKey<TKey, TValue, TSep>>>;
    /**
     * Sets the data source name of the last data source added to the builder.
     * @param name Name for the data source.
     */
    name(name: string): IBuilder<T>;
    /**
     * Makes the last-added data source conditionally inclusive.
     * @param predicate Predicate function that is run whenever the build function runs.  If the predicate returns 
     * true, then the data source will be included; if it returns false, then the data source is skipped.
     * @param dataSourceName Optional data source name.  Provided to simplify the build chain and is merely a 
     * shortcut to include a call to the name() function.  Equivalent to when().name().
     */
    when(predicate: () => boolean, dataSourceName?: string): IBuilder<T>;
    /**
    * Adds the provided environment object as a property of the final configuration object.
    * @param env Previously created environment object.
    * @param propertyName Optional property name for the environment object.
    */
    includeEnvironment<TEnvironments extends string, TEnvironmentKey extends string = "environment">(
        env: IEnvironment<TEnvironments>,
        propertyName?: TEnvironmentKey
    ): IEnvAwareBuilder<TEnvironments, Omit<T, TEnvironmentKey> & IncludeEnvironment<TEnvironments, TEnvironmentKey>>;
    /**
     * Creates URL functions in the final configuration object for URL's defined according to the wj-config standard.
     * @param wsPropertyNames Optional list of property names whose values are expected to be objects that contain 
     * host, port, scheme or root path data at some point in their child hierarchy.  If not provided, then the default 
     * list will be used.  It can also be a single string, which is the same as a 1-element array.
     * @param routeValueRegExp Optional regular expression used to identify replaceable route values.  If this is not 
     * provided, then the default regular expression will match route values of the form {<route value name>}, such as 
     * {code} or {id}.
     */
    createUrlFunctions<TUrl extends keyof T>(wsPropertyNames: TUrl | TUrl[], routeValueRegExp?: RegExp): IBuilder<Omit<T, TUrl> & UrlBuilderSectionWithCheck<T, TUrl>>;
    /**
     * Asynchronously builds the final configuration object.
     */
    build(traceValueSources?: boolean): Promise<T>;
    /**
     * Defines a post-merge operation.  Post-merge operations are run after all the data sources have been merged and 
     * after all URL functions have been created, and allow the developer to perform additional processing on the final 
     * configuration object.
     * 
     * Any number of post-merge operations can be defined; these are run in the order they are provided, each being fed 
     * the configuration object that the previous post-merge operation returns.
     * 
     * This is useful for things like creating composite values.  The use-case that inspired this feature is the 
     * creation of scopes for Azure SSO.
     * 
     * @example
     * 
     * A configuration JSON file containing SSO configuration might look like this:
     * 
     * ```json
     * {
     *   "sso": {
     *     "auth": {
     *       "clientId": "12345678-1234-1234-1234-123456789012",
     *       "redirectUri": "/",
     *       "authority": "https://login.microsoftonline.com/common",
     *       "clientCapabilities": [ "CP1" ]
     *     },
     *     "scopes": [ "some.api.access" ]
*        }
     * }
     * ```
     * 
     * Scopes are usually in the form `"api://{clientId}/{scope}"`, so the post-merge function can be used to replace 
     * the scopes in the config JSON file with scopes of the above form.  The advantage over just typing them already 
     * in this format?  You don't have to repeat the client ID on every scope.  We are all about DRY configuration.
     * 
     * ```ts
     * export default await wjConfig()
     *     ...
     *     .postMerge(c => c.sso.scopes = c.sso.scopes.map(s => `api://${c.sso.auth.clientId}/${s}`))
     *     .build();
     * ```
     * 
     * @param fn Function that receives the (otherwise) final configuration object and allows the developer to perform 
     * additional processing on it.  The function must return the modified object, which is passed to the next post 
     * merge function.
     */
    postMerge<U extends Record<string, any> = T>(fn: (config: T) => U | Promise<U>): IBuilder<U>;
}

/**
 * Function type that allows environment objects to declare testing functions, such as isProduction().
 */
export type EnvironmentTestFn = () => boolean;

/**
 * Defines the capabilities required from environment objects.
 */
export type IEnvironment<TEnvironments extends string> = {
    [K in TEnvironments as `is${Capitalize<K>}`]: EnvironmentTestFn;
} & {
    /**
     * The current environment (represented by an environment definition).
     */
    readonly current: IEnvironmentDefinition<Exclude<TEnvironments, undefined>>;

    /**
     * The list of known environments (represented by a list of environment definitions).
     */
    readonly all: TEnvironments[];

    /**
     * Tests the current environment definition for the presence of the specified traits.  It will return true 
     * only if all specified traits are present; othewise it will return false.
     * @param traits The environment traits expected to be found in the current environment definition.
     */
    hasTraits(traits: Traits): boolean;

    /**
     * Tests the current environment definition for the presence of any of the specified traits.  It will return 
     * true if any of the specified traits is present.  If none of the specified traits are present, then the 
     * return value will be false.
     * @param traits The environments traits of which at least on of them is expected to be found in the current 
     * environment definition.
     */
    hasAnyTrait(traits: Traits): boolean;
}

/**
 * Utility type that extracts the environment names from a constant list of possible names.
 * 
 * @example
 * ```ts
 * const envs = ['Development', 'Staging', 'Production'] as const;
 * type EnvName = EnvironmentName<typeof envs>; // 'Development' | 'Staging' | 'Production'
 * 
 * const env = buildEnvironment(process.env.NODE_ENV as EnvName, envs);
 * env.isDevelopment(); // true if the current environment is 'Development'
 * env.isStaging(); // true if the current environment is 'Staging'
 * env.isProduction(); // true if the current environment is 'Production'
 * ```
 * 
 * Without the type casting (`as EnvName`), the `isXXX()` functions would not show up in Intellisense, as the type of 
 * `env` would be`IEnvironment<string>`.
 */
export type EnvironmentName<T extends readonly string[]> = T[number];
